Saudi Arabia: King Salman Energy Park’s Logistics Zone to begin operations in 2024
King Salman Energy Park (SPARK) has said that its Logistics Zone will begin operations in 2024. The Logistics Zone, an advanced, fully automated district, will feature the first and largest private dry port in the region, on-site customs clearance services and bonded warehouses. Saudi Arabia receives 7.8 million tourists in Q1 2023
Saudi Arabia’s Ministry of Tourism said that the country received 7.8 million tourists during the first quarter of 2023. That figure, it says, represents its highest quarterly performance, and was achieved on the back of a 64 per cent growth compared to the same period in 2019. Jada Fund collaborates with Aliph Capital to support Saudi SMEs
Jada Fund of Funds Company, a Saudi Arabia PIF-owned company, has strategically partnered with GCC-led investment manager, Aliph Capital, to support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s). SAUDIA Group allocated 1.2 million seats for 2023 Hajj season
SAUDIA Group has revealed its operational performance during the peak of the summer travel season from May 21-August 2, 2023, which included this year’s Hajj season.
